Black Soldier Fly Larve eventually pupate and turn into Soldier Flies. Soldier Flies are large, slow moving flies (Resembling wasps) that have NO MOUTHS (They are not germ carrying vectors like house flies). The Soldier Flies live only days. During this time they mate and look for a place near rotting vegetation to lay their eggs. Soldier Flies would not want to come into your house as they LOVE sunlight. The flies that have hatched in my garage can be seen buzzing around my garage door window looking to get out as soon as I open the door. As soon as the Soldier Fly lays it’s eggs, it dies within hours.

Why Black Soldier Fly Larve? At 42% protein and 34% fat, Soldier Fly Grubs are an EXCELLENT food source for any meat eater.
1. Nutritious Songbird Feeders. Soldier grubs are an ideal food for attracting bluebirds, or any other meat eating bird.
2. Ornamental Fishpond / Aquarium Feed. Soldier Fly Grubs are high in usable protein and low in ash. Your goldfish, koi, large cichlids and other pond creatures will relish the live, fresh grubs that are simple to dispense in a tank or backyard pond.
3. Live Fishing Bait. Home-grown solider grubs are easy to store, simple to transport and a pleasure to bait on a hook – their durable bodies don’t fall apart or get easily ripped up by hungry fish.
4. Raising Chickens. Chickens love to scratch the dirt endlessly looking for tasty grubs and other insects. A few handfuls a day of soldier grubs scattered throughout the garden will provide hours of enjoyment for your friends and family.
5. Freshwater Aquaculture or Aquaponics. Raising domesticated freshwater bass, catfish, bullfrogs or tilapia in a small pond or converted pool is a cost-effective and sustainable means of supplying you family with a healthy, year-round protein source. Live or dried soldier grubs may be fed directly to your stock, reducing demand for commercial grade feed.
